Margins and return-on-capital ratios measuring operating efficiency
RXO, Inc. earns an operating margin of -0.1%, below the Industrials sector average of 4.9%. Operating margins have compressed from 1.0% to -0.1% over the past 3 years, signaling potential cost pressures or competitive headwinds. A negative ROE of -6.3% indicates the company is currently destroying shareholder equity.

Solvency and debt-coverage ratios — lower is generally safer
RXO, Inc. carries a Debt/EBITDA ratio of 7.9x, which is highly leveraged (147% above the sector average of 3.2x). Net debt stands at $843M ($861M total debt minus $18M cash).
